Zero-waste timber processing: maximising every resource


The students' next stop was SDL's sawmill, acquired in 2023. which demonstrated how vertical integration creates value from every piece of timber. Here, they witnessed the wood sorting process that grades the quality of the wood. Whilst the construction markets use better quality wood, SDL still collect and reuse lower quality wood and waste sawdust at other stages.


For the students, this represented a revelation about waste management in practice. Qiaohui reflected on the experience and said, "I'm surprised just how little we waste throughout the whole process." His surprise echoes a common misconception about forestry operations, that significant waste is inevitable.


SDL's sawmill investment has completed their 360° biomass supply loop. This addition eliminates third-party dependencies while creating multiple revenue streams from single timber inputs. CHP biomass: converting understanding to energy


Dean Close Work Experience at SDL Pellets and CHP Biomass plant.

The centerpiece of the students' journey was SDL's Combined Heat and Power (CHP) plant at Stanley's Quarry. This plant is one of a kind and a unique design in England. Powered entirely by brash and low-quality woodchip from SDL's own operations, this facility represents significant engineering achievement that impressed even technically-minded students.


Qiaohui identified this as the most forward-thinking part of SDL's operation. He said: "The zero waste in the process and the biomass energy plant." His recognition of the plant's innovation reflects its genuine technical significance:


  • Grid Connection: Licensed power generation feeding the national grid since March 2017

  • Fuel Integration: 100% waste wood and forestry residuals from SDL's own forestry and site clearance operations

  • Heat Recovery: Thermal energy supports adjacent pellet production facility and wood drying facilities

  • Scale: England's largest biomass CHP plant of its type

State-of-the-art wood pellet production: innovation in practice


In 2021, SDL Pellets was installed and the design was the largest wood pellet production facility of its kind in England. This was the final stop on the students work experience journey with SDL. Here, they witnessed the seamless integration of heat from the CHP plant supporting EN Plus A1 grade pellet production.
